Revenue notes and bonds of the Commission issued pursuant to the provisions of this act shall not constitute a debt of the state or of any political subdivision thereof, or a pledge of the full faith and credit of the state, or of any political subdivision thereof, but such notes and bonds shall be payable solely from the funds provided therefrom.
